Translation

Oh, how fine is this brass barrel with its roaring muzzle, just like the fatal lion’s jaws! It is a charming gift of Lord Auckland, Governor General of India, which he ordered to be donated to Maharajah Ranjit [Singh] as a token of his pure friendship, And to date in history this exaltingly roaring gun, its crew have said: “Aim at the day of Victory!” 1838 AD, Christian Era

Note:

This cannon was a gift from Lord Auckland  huge admirer of Maharajah Ranjit Singh.   The gun was handed to Ranjit Singh at a time hen relations between the Kingdom and the Empire was still strong.
